Recommended Operating Conditions

over operating free-air temperature range (unless otherwise noted)(1)
MIN NOM MAX UNIT
VS Supply voltage, VS = (V+) – (V–) 1.6 5.5 V
TA Temperature(2) –40 125 °C
Absolute Maximum Ratings indicate limits beyond which damage may occur. Recommended Operating Conditions indicate conditions for which the device is intended to be functional, but specific performance is not tested. For tested specifications and test conditions, see Electrical Characteristics.
The maximum power dissipation is a function of TJ(MAX), θJA. The maximum allowable power dissipation at any ambient temperature is PD = (TJ(MAX) – TA) / θJA. All numbers apply for packages soldered directly onto a PCB.
